Geely Okavango is a large family crossover. It provides comfort both on routine trips and when traveling. Seven seats for the whole family.

200 hp Power
7.7 l / 100 km Avg. fuel consumption*
9.6 s Acceleration 0-100 km/h

The design of the Geely Okavango meets all modern trends, inspires confidence and attracts attention on the road. The radiator grille, designed in the “ice waterfall” concept, emphasizes the solidity of the car.

The interior of the Geely Okavango has a precise and balanced design. High-quality soft plastic and eco-leather provide maximum comfort on every trip. The large panoramic roof brings plenty of light into the cabin, and dual-zone climate control with separate air ducts for the second and third rows of seats creates a comfortable atmosphere for all passengers. The ability to fold the seats in a variety of different configurations allows you to find the ideal passenger and cargo arrangement depending on the situation.

The third row of seats can be easily folded and unfolded if necessary. Passengers up to 180 cm tall can comfortably accommodate passengers up to 180 cm tall in two separate chairs. For comfortable travel, separate air ducts are located on the sides, and there is also a function for adjusting the intensity of air ventilation.

The interior of the new Okavango provides truly limitless possibilities for transporting passengers and cargo due to the many options for transforming the seats. The generous 2,360-litre load compartment and generous 2.2-metre long cargo area provide plenty of space to carry large items when the seats are folded down.

Thanks to the keyless entry system, there is no need to take the key out of your pocket to open the car.
You can open and close the tailgate very easily and in different ways:

• Button on the key
• Button on the panel on the left under the steering wheel
• Button on the tailgate
• Automatically contactless

Lensed LED headlights, highlighted by three-segment running lights, enhance driving safety at night and in bad weather.

The light pattern on the rear underlines the Okavango's individuality. Bright LED lights promote safe movement in any weather and at any time of the day or night.

The modern 2.0-liter 4-cylinder turbocharged engine develops power up to 200 hp. and torque up to 325 N∙m. It was developed jointly by Swedish and Chinese Geely engineers. Due to the technologies used, acceleration from zero to 100 km/h in the new Geely Okavango is 9.6 seconds. With such dynamic potential, the engine is quite economical - in the combined cycle, fuel consumption is 7.7 l/100 km* (NEDC cycle).

The automatic 7-speed oil-cooled dual wet clutch transmission (7DCT) shifts quickly and precisely for dynamic acceleration and smooth deceleration. This innovative unit is highly reliable and provides fuel savings.

Using a special selector on the center console, you can select the appropriate driving mode - Comfortable, Economical, Sports.

A high level of passive safety has been achieved thanks to the widespread use of high-strength steel in the load-bearing structure of the body. In all trim levels, Geely Okavango is equipped with modern passive safety systems:

• 6 airbags
• Three-point seat belts with pretensioners and load limiters
• Front and rear seat belt warning function
• ISOFIX child seat anchors on the 2nd row outboard seats
• Child lock on the rear doors

Geely Okavango has an improved, comfortably tuned chassis with rear multi-link independent suspension, as well as a modern brake system control system, which includes the following systems:

- Electronic Stability Control (ESC) and Traction Control System (TCS)
- Anti-lock braking system (ABS) with electronic brake force distribution (EBD)
- Rollover mitigation system (ARP)
- Emergency Brake Alarm System (ESS)
- Emergency Brake Assist (EBA)
- Hill Start Assist (HAC) and Downhill Assist (HDC)

The vehicle constantly monitors the blind spots on both sides. The advanced collision monitoring program transmits an acoustic warning signal and a light signal on the indicator integrated into the mirrors. If a moving object is detected in the blind spot, the system will warn you about the danger when opening the doors before leaving the vehicle (DOW), assist when reversing out of parking spaces (RCTA) and when changing lanes (LCA), and also prevent rear collision warning (RCW). ), giving a preemptive signal to a car quickly approaching from behind.
